Scenario: You are the CRO for the AZ Copper Company (AZCC). AZCC is in the business of mining and smelting copper. AZCC then sells the bulk copper to wholesalers, who then sell the copper to various firms that use the copper as an input in the manufacturing process (e.g., appliance manufacturers, copper wire manufacturers, computer hardware manufacturers, automobile manufactures, etc.). AZCC only sells to three wholesalers – two are located in the U.S. and one is located in Mexico. All of the wholesalers purchase copper with payment due within 14 days. Copper mining is also a notoriously dangerous business given the use of heavy equipment, and is environmentally sensitive given the use of chemicals like cyanide for extracting copper used in the mining process. Question: As the CRO, you are asked to build a risk register outlining the various risks faced by AZCC. In doing this, outline 4 risks in the risk register (note – there are certainly more than 4 risks that can be considered in this scenario). You have flexibility in how to develop your risk register, but should at least consider the exposure, classification of risk (e.g., market risk, credit risk, hazard risk etc.), likelihood, and severity. With respect to likelihood and severity, develop your own scale.
